    Effectiveness of a mobile app-based educational intervention to treat internet gaming disorder among Iranian adolescents: study protocol for a randomized controlled trial

    Background: The use of video games, a hobby for many teenagers in their leisure time, has brought with it a new potential for concerns. Internet gaming disorder (IGD) is a mental condition classified as a disorder due to addictive behaviors. It may include use of video games, both online and offline. Consequences of IGD may include introversion, social anxiety, mood swings, loneliness, sleep problems, behavioral problems, depression, low selfesteem, and increased violence. In order to design an app-based intervention for adolescents, a transtheoretical model (TTM) has been used. This widely used model in the field of behavioral change is also practical for health education programs. In addition, cognitive-behavioral therapy (CBT) has been used to make people more aware of their behaviors, feelings and thoughts and how to achieve behavioral change. The present study seeks to determine the effectiveness of this app-based intervention in in the treatment of IGD among adolescents. Method: In this single-blinded, randomized, controlled trial, 206 high-school adolescents aged 13 to 18 years in Qazvin city will be recruited. Eligible adolescents will be randomly assigned into intervention and control groups. Eight consecutive sessions delivered over 2 months and based on the TTM and CBT will be delivered through the `app (named HAPPYTEEN) to the intervention group. The control group will receive a sleep hygiene intervention (8 consecutive sessions for 2 months) via the app. Data collection tools include the Internet Gaming Disorder Scale, Insomnia Severity Index, Depression, Anxiety, and Stress Scales, Stages of Change Questionnaire, Decision Balance, and Self-Efficacy. The study measures will be completed at baseline, post intervention, and 1 month and 3 months after the intervention. Discussion: The results of this intervention could be used as adjunct therapy for adolescents with IGD

    Estimation of sleep problems among pregnant women during COVID-19 pandemic: a systematic review and meta-analysis

    Objective To estimate the sleep problems among pregnant women during the COVID-19 pandemic. Eligibility criteria English, peer-reviewed, observational studies published between December 2019 and July 2021 which assessed and reported sleep problem prevalence using a valid and reliable measure were included. Information sources Scopus, Medline/PubMed Central, ProQuest, ISI Web of Knowledge and Embase. Risk of bias assessment tool The Newcastle-Ottawa Scale checklist. Synthesis of results Prevalence of sleep problems was synthesised using STATA software V.14 using a random effects model. To assess moderator analysis, meta-regression was carried out. Funnel plot and Egger’s test were used to assess publication bias. Meta-trim was used to correct probable publication bias. The jackknife method was used for sensitivity analysis. Included studies A total of seven cross-sectional studies with 2808 participants from four countries were included. Synthesis of results The pooled estimated prevalence of sleep problems was 56% (95% CI 23% to 88%, I2=99.81%, Tau2=0.19). Due to the probability of publication bias, the fill-and- trim method was used to correct the estimated pooled measure, which imputed four studies. The corrected results based on this method showed that pooled prevalence of sleep problems was 13% (95% CI 0% to 45%; p<0.001). Based on meta-regression, age was the only significant predictor of prevalence of sleep problems among pregnant women. Limitations of evidence All studies were cross-sectional absence of assessment of sleep problems prior to COVID-19, and the outcomes of the pregnancies among those with and without sleep problems in a consistent manner are among the limitation of the current review. Interpretation Pregnant women have experienced significant declines in sleep quality when faced with the COVID-19 pandemic. The short-term and long-term implications of such alterations in sleep on gestational and offspring outcomes are unclear and warrant further studies. PROSPERO registration number CRD42020181644

    Clinical and Laboratory-based Diagnosis in Cases Suspected with COVID-19; An Updated and Comprehensive Systematic Review Study

    Objectives A novel coronavirus disease 2019 (COVID-19) was identified in Wuhan, China, which quickly involved majority of the countries all around the world. Due to the high rate of mortality and morbidity, needless to say the importance of accurate and early diagnosis, especially in suspected and asymptomatic cases. Hence, in this article, authors tried to provide practical and standardized diagnostic approaches for cases suspected with COVID-19 infection. Material and Methods Data of this review study were collected from 7 search engine/databases, commencing from December 2019 to June 2021 by using 6 keywords according to Medical Subject Headings (MeSH) terms and our inclusion/exclusion criteria. Result Due to various clinical manifestations of COVID-19, and high potential for mutagenicity, identification of suspected patients is of great importance for effective control of infection, and improvement of clinical decisions. Therefore, medical history of the patients, clinical signs and symptoms, chest computational tomography, serological and molecular diagnosis can be effective in faster identification of mentioned patients. In spite of the fact that molecular tests have been considered as the gold standard for diagnosis of COVID-19, but there is still high rate of falsenegativity. Then, combinative usage of the complementary tests can reduce any misinterpretations for suspected cases. Conclusion Screening for suspected cases in the shortest possible turnaround time is dependent on the appropriate diagnostic approaches. Subsequently, this allows physicians immediately provide proper medical interventions for suspected patients who are at greater risk for developing more serious complications than COVID-19 like severe nosocomial infections.
